Murumdag is a Rural village located in Itkhori, Chatra, Jharkhand.
The total population of Murumdag is 514.
Murumdag village comprises 67 households.
The literacy rate in Murumdag is 62.7%. Among the literate population of 262, there are 162 literate males and 100 literate females.
In Murumdag, there are 264 males and 250 females, with a sex ratio of 947 females per 1000 males.
There are 96 children (18.7% of population), comprising 51 boys and 45 girls.
The total number of workers in Murumdag is 227, with 110 main workers and 117 marginal workers.

Murumdag is located in Jharkhand state, Chatra district, and falls under Itkhori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 349068 and LGD code is 349068.
